Student loan refinancing works by taking out a new loan to pay off existing student loans. The new loan typically comes with better terms and payment conditions. This process can potentially lower your monthly payments, reduce the overall interest you’ll pay, and simplify your repayment by having just one loan to manage.
If you find yourself unable to make payments after refinancing, it’s crucial to address the situation promptly. Reach out to them as soon as possible to discuss your financial hardship and explore potential solutions, such as deferment, forbearance, or modified repayment plans.
Aspire Student Loan Refinance allows borrowers to refinance both federal and private student loans, whether undergraduate or graduate. This includes Direct Subsidized and Unsubsidized Loans, PLUS Loans, Perkins Loans, and private student loans from banks or other lenders. For more details, check our full review.
Whether you need a cosigner for Aspire Student Loan Refinance depends on your creditworthiness. A cosigner may be required if your credit score or financial situation does not meet their criteria.
